Ammonites are the fossilized, coiled shells of extinct marine cephalopods that lived between 240 and 66 million years ago. They are related to modern squid and nautilus and these predatory creatures lived in the outer chambers of their spiraled shells, using the inner chambers for bouyancy. They became extinct at the end of the Cretaceous period, roughly 66 million years ago. You will receive the exact fossil shown.
